Ghanaian international Jordan Ayew says he always gives his best when he is on the field for his club Crystal Palace.
Ayew mentioned that there are ups and downs in the game and though he is having goal drought, he always offer everything when he is playing.
“I’ve been in the game for quite a long time now,” he said. “There are some periods in your life where things don’t go your way, and some periods where they go your way. I’ve had that period for a couple of months.
“But you keep working hard. I wake up every morning proud of what I’ve achieved in football. I wake up every morning knowing that when I come to train, I will give 100%, and when I play for Crystal Palace I will give 100%.
“When I go home I will have no regrets because I know I have given 100%. That is what is important for me.”
Ayew has been used in various positions upfront by Patrick Vieira depending on the team they are facing and he has earned praises from the French manager for his output.
